Compared with traditional box furnaces, vacuum elevator furnaces offer distinct advantages in structure, safety, and performance:
The equipment is equipped with a loading table featuring lead screw lifting and optical axis guiding, with adjustable rotation and stirring functions. It adopts three-layer thermal insulation and air-cooling for temperature reduction, keeping the shell temperature ≤45℃. It supports 30-segment program temperature control and RS485 remote operation, with durable buttons equipped with indicator lights.
Power supply: 220V/380V. Temperature measurement: Platinum-rhodium S-type thermocouple. Heating: Silicon carbide rods heating around the furnace. Furnace lining: High-purity alumina. Equipped with a vacuum pump and gas protection system, as well as RS485/USB communication interfaces.
